John Yuhas
John Joseph Yuhas Sr., 91, of Montezuma, died July 9, 2013, at Wilson Hospital in Sidney.
He was born Oct. 15, 1921, in Pennsylvania, to Joseph and Mary Semansky Yuhas.
He is survived by a son, John (Elfriede) Yuhas Jr. of El Paso, Texas; a stepson, David (Teresa) Conley of Coldwater; two grandchildren; six great-grandchildren; and two brothers, Bernie Yuhas and Eddy Yuhas of Trenton, N.J.
He was preceded in death by a son, Michael Edward Yuhas; a daughter, Donna Lynn Stewart; and a brother, Joseph Yuhas.
He served in the U.S. Army during World War II and was a lifetime member of the Coldwater American Legion.
Graveside military services will be 10 a.m. Saturday at Glen Haven Memorial Gardens in New Carlisle.
